Besides specifying the goals of the project, a time and materials contract should include a fixed price for labor that includes wages, overhead, general and administrative costs and a markup for profit. Materials cost should include freight, taxes and a standard markup usually between 15% and 35%.
Disadvantages of TM Contracts You have to deal with the extensive process of actively tracking the materials being used for the project as well as the billable hours, which can be difficult to achieve, especially as youre running your own small business.
A time and materials contract requires a client to pay for a contractors time and money spent on materials. They usually specify an hourly rate plus a markup for materials. While many of these contracts are based on an estimate, the estimate may not be the full price required at the end of the project.
A time-and-materials contract may be used only when it is not possible at the time of placing the contract to estimate accurately the extent or duration of the work or to anticipate costs with any reasonable degree of confidence.
Advantages: With assurances that all costs will be covered, time and materials contracts are simple to implement and a low risk for the contractor. Profit is predictable. Adjustments are easy when specifications or resource needs change.
Negatives. Not all homeowners like time and materials contracts because they arent time specific. If the project takes longer, then the homeowner will have to pay more. Also, if more materials are needed, then the homeowner will need to pay as well.
